Vulcan Thermally Modified Timber Decking

Abodo’s Vulcan Decking is created from thermally modified NZ plantation timber and then treated with an organic preservative system that includes a water repellent for superior durability resulting in enhanced stability, reduced resin content and is a beautiful homogeneous brown colour which will silver off or can be stained on site.

Perfect for hot, exposed conditions, it is designed with lifetime beauty in mind, even in harsh coastal aplications and designed to be installed grip tread up.

Shadowdeck

As NZ’s only BRANZ appraised hidden deck fastener, the ShadowDeck system creates an unbeatable nail-free finish every time.

It is 100% FSC certified, comes with a slight dome profile on the top side of the boards to aide water-shed, is pre-grooved on the edges to make it easier to install with the hidden deck fastener, and is pre-oiled on all sides before it arrives on-site which means the timber won’t cup, and has minimal contraction and expansion.

The result is a smarter looking and longer lasting deck which stands the test of time and is well proven in NZ’s harsh UV conditions.

Accoya

Accoya Decking utilises the world's leading technology for wood modification, Acetylation. It is a non-toxic cellular modification process resulting in durable, stable and non-toxic decking with performance characteristics better than any hardwood. Radiata Pine is sourced from sustainably managed forests in NZ to compliment the environmental ethos of the product. Stringent quality control measures throughout production ensures consistent performance when installed into the NZ environment. Available in either dressed smooth or Band sawn face finish. Accoya decking can be either stained or just left to weather naturally.

Bamboo Composite

Eva-Last I series is a New premium composite decking range created using the latest in co-extruded bamboo-plastic composite (BPC) technology. An advanced protective cap offers the ultimate in composite durability, and long-lasting stability. It is backed by an industry leading 25-year warranty, which includes coverage for stain, fade and scratch-resistance. Available in 4 natural colours with a new and improved embossed pattern to give the aesthetic of timber without the maintenance or environmental impact. It is 40% lighter and twice as strong as standard composite decking but at a lower price point.

Outdure

ResortDeck with UltraShield is a high performance recycled composite board and fascia range that looks like hardwood timber decking but requires no staining, painting, is splinter and nail-free, and capped for moisture and UV resistance.

ResortDeck can be installed on a traditional timber sub-frame or for a fast, straight, level solution that doesn’t rot, use Outdure’s QwickBuild exterior flooring system, comprised of Global Green Tag certified aluminium framing and components and patented hidden fastenings to support decking, tiles, and turf.

QwickBuild comes in a range of joist-bearer profiles to suit all deck projects and heights from ultra-low to raised decks. The versatile system can be used over ground, membrane, concrete, pavers and makes it easy to achieve the valuable flush-finish between the interior floor level and deck area Other decking types are also available.
